ACT FIVE SCENE FIFTEEN

2 0 0
                                    

[Johnson was in a poorly lit investigation room when one of the officers walked in to announce his freedom].

POLICE:  You must have guardian angels Mr. Johnson.

JOHNSON: [All beat up and exhausted from the crude interrogation.] How do you mean, officer?

POLICE:  Well you are free to go?

JOHNSON: Please officer, how?

POLICE:  We found evidence supporting your stories. It was actually self defense. However, the families of the late Professor Titus are not pressing any charges for deliberately withholding information and improper deposition of the remains.

JOHNSON: Are you for rea, officer?

POLICE:  Your effort in retrieving the voice record about the plot to ruin the institutions in Ekuma have led to the fall of a powerful syndicate in the town.

JOHNSON: Amazing!

POLICE:  Thanks to your attorney, the paper work have been taken care of.

JOHNSON: My attorney? Who?

[Lala walked into the interrogation room to his surprise. He was different. He was dressed in fine sleek suit and nice shoes.]

 

[Before he could implicate himself, Lala stylishly motioned him to keep quiet, by trying to pick his nose].

LALA:  Time to go home, Mr. Johnson. Time to go home.

[He guided him through and out of the investigation room as the door closed against their back.]
